Regular Residence Coverage Premiums

Residence protection costs are diverse for rented and owned properties. Tenants coverage for rented households covers the basic contents of a household and several liability (you might require a different plan for wonderful art, wine collections, furs, as well as other high-priced, atypical things). Tenants insurance plan is often less costly than homeowners insurance policyStandardinsurance.co.

Homeowners insurance policies covers the making and its exterior, and also risks connected to theft, fire, earthquake, and many others. Considering that the value of the building is much bigger compared to the contents of a rented device, homeowners coverage premiums are substantially higher than are definitely the premiums for tenants insurance policies.

Flooding Coverage for Households in Calgary

Considering the fact that Calgary often sees flooding, just about every homeowner need to be geared up for the potential for this danger and will comprehend the primary facets of house protection and flooding. Another thing you should Remember is always that property security within the flood-endangered regions of town is dearer as a result of Substantially larger possibility.

There are 4 most important forms of flooding. It is crucial to understand that your property insurance policy policy treats Each and every of them otherwise:

one. Overland flooding takes place like a consequence of water (rain or melting snow) moving into your own home from the outdoors. Standard coverage in Calgary isn't going to protect fees from overland flooding. Having said that, some providers do deliver coverage for this type of flooding at an additional Price.

2. Roof leakage may be included or not coated, dependant upon the elements that brought about it. In case the roof was in very poor affliction from the beginning, your insurance service provider is not going to deal with the damage. Your property insurance will more than likely cover destruction from the organic induce, like hail.

3. Your insurance company will cover plumbing troubles, provided that you adjust to the rules within your plan, like owning any individual stop by your property when you are not there for prolonged periods of time (for example, while you're on holiday).

four. Sewer backup transpires when wastewater is pushed back again into your house. Common property safety isn't going to include this kind of flooding. Even so, you may always order this kind of coverage as an addition to your own home coverage plan.

The Distinction between Condo and Tenants Insurance in Calgary

House owners of condos can buy homeowners insurance policy for their condo. The condominium Company purchases business condo insurance. The distinction between these two policies is in what A part of the condo they deal with. The homeowners insurance plan addresses the contents in the condominium. The protection also consists of defense for updates, locker contents, 3rd party legal responsibility, theft, further residing charges, and often Unique insurance policies assessments.

The professional condominium corporation's insurance policies addresses the constructing's exterior (envelope), along with its infrastructure and customary spots.

Condo renters in Calgary will need tenants insurance plan to protect the contents in their condos. This type of protection is often necessary and is a component of your rental contract. Together with the protection of contents from theft, fireplace, together with other hazards, the insurance coverage also extends to third party legal responsibility and additional dwelling bills. Living costs are with the instances once the condo is unlivable (on account of earthquake, flood, fireplace, and so forth.), so the renter is compelled to are in a lodge or rental unit right up until the condo repairs are finish.
